The Evolution of Romantic Storylines in Santali: A Glimpse into Tribal Life

In digital storylines, the Jhumur dance—a slow, hypnotic rhythmic dance—is often used as a metaphor for the push-and-pull of a relationship. A well-written Santali romance will describe the male protagonist watching the female lead dance Jhumur , her anklets speaking a language his mouth cannot.

Beyond real-life customs, Santal mythology is rich with tragic and triumphant love stories that explain the universe.
